I need to jack up the car and remove rearend etc. and was wondering if there is a proper place to put jack stands on a 67 ,is my first uni body car
 
Place the jack stands on the frame rails just forward of the rear wheel house.l, where the frame rails level out. I would also chock the front wheels and stack both rear wheels and place under the gas tank nice and tight.
 
I like to place stands right on the brace (hanger mount) that the front spring hanger bolts to and there's very little chance of the stand slipping if it's placed there. If you place the stands on the frame rail, I like for the car to be level so I also jack up the front too but if you place the stand on the hanger mount, raising the front isn't needed.
